The German National Library in cooperation with the Institute for Children’s Book Research of Goethe University Frankfurt am Main extend a cordial invitation to leaf through children’s worlds of a present-day picture book. Stories relate in quite different ways to Struwwelpeter as original text of the modern book.















The design structures the exhibition called Struwwelpeter´s Descendants in various, perceptible and interactive spaces. On the one hand you can find the characters like in a kitchen, the bathroom or the living room, on the other hand the Wild Huntsman, Johnny Head-in-Air or the Inky Boys are located in a garden area with fencing and a big tree. An interactive stockpot tells the story Kaspar, a postcard flies away with the message of Robert and the Cruel Frederik presents his soft, innocuous and unbreakable chairs and rolling pin.
